    There are a couple of articles floating around from earlier in the season and more recently where Marvin is pretty livid about TO and Chad barely going thru the motions on non-passing plays (blocking for Benson - stretching the field, picking up the safety etc.). With both TO and Chad out for this game Shipley and Jerome Simpson moved into those positions and gave 110% and it had a big effect on the run effectiveness.. Benson in turn highly praised both Ship and Simpson on Monday for doing their job.

    These are criticisms long associated with TO and Moss types. Explains alot as to why Marvin wanted to bench TO for the rest of the season even though he technically was having a very decent year receiving.
